Coupling environmental evolution and social developments in east silk road during past 2000 years abstract

The silk road was a transcontinental network of trader routes formally established during the han dynasty of china, which connecting the east and weast recently, it has been rejvenated as the chinese lasder jinping Xi proposed the belt and road initative a develpment strategy and framework that focused on connevtivity and cooperation among countries primarily between the china and the rest of eurasia. passing through the environmental vulnerable arid and semi- arid northwest china, the east silk road and suroundings experienced several episodes of prosperity or decline responding to climatic variations and human acitvities . it suffered from water scarcity, glacial retreat permafrost degradation, lake shrink, desett expansion and severe soil erosion during the past 2.000 year, which severely constrained the reginal social and econmic development. this study firstly reviews the history of regional climate change, social develompent rise and decline of the silk road, then couples environment evolution and social development during the past 2.000 years, finaly draws implications for further ecological restoration and social develpment. the main conclusiaons are as following.
